    EMI Shielding for RADAR cable

    Hi All- I just wanted to note that when I started cutting cable for the installation, I noticed both the network and the power cable are shielded internally. Seems like Garmin has a "catch all" phrase for every situation in their instructions. covering their bases, so to speak. Thanks, Mike
